Simulation of multilane vehicle traffic flows based on the cellular automata theory

M. A. Trapeznikovaa, I. R. Furmanova, N. G. Churbanovaa, R. Lippb

a M. V. Keldysh Institute for Applied Mathematics, Russian Academy of Sciences, Moscow
b Association “StrassenHaus”

Abstract: A two-dimensional microscopic model of multilane vehicle traffic flows is proposed in the work. Performed test predictions verified its adequacy. The model was used to study numerically traffic capacity of a crossroad at different traffic lights modes as well as to compare traffic capacities of roads depending on the presence and the number of entries – exits.

Keywords: microscopic and macroscopic traffic flow models, cellular automata, multilane road, traffic capacity.
